Indias Fastest Car The Audi R8 V10 Breaks Quarter Mile National Record

India’s fastest car, the Audi R8 V10, breaks quarter-mile national record.

Rounds 1 and 2 of the FMSCI Indian National Drag Racing Championship 2025 were record-breaking. The three-day championship took place at Taneja Aerospace in Hosur, on the outskirts of Bengaluru, from April 18 to 20. Sean Rogers Pachigalla's twin-turbo Audi R8 bettered his quarter-mile record of 9.215 seconds, which he had achieved at the Valley Run in 2024.

Twin-Turbo Audi R8 is the fastest car in India

Pachigalla, who was running in the top open class, posted a 9.635-second time in Round 1 on Friday over the 402-metre distance. He ran 8.948 seconds in Round 2 on Sunday, which was also a new national record. He also won the Indian Open M3 (Unlimited) class on Sunday by posting an 8.955-second time.

Still, his quickest dash was at the Vroom Drag Meet – an event supporting meet – where he clocked an incredible 8.849 seconds, breaking his own national best. Pachigalla's Audi R8 V10+, Venom Performance-tuned and powered by a Sheepey Race twin-turbo kit delivering more than 1600hp, is now officially the quickest car in India over the quarter-mile – and the first to break through the 9-second barrier.

Among the other features, 80-year-old Vidyaprakash Damondaran, the oldest participant in the event, was unbeaten in the Pro-Stock 3061cc-4002cc category in both rounds, driving his Audi TT. Bengaluru's Shreyas Mahendra won three categories – Pro-Stock 2051-2550cc, Indian Open M1, and M2 – in Round 1.

FMSCI Indian National Drag Racing Championship 2025 results

CategoryCompetitorTime (secs)
Unrestricted (N1)Sean Rogers Pachigalla9.635
Pro-Stock K2 (1151cc – 1450cc)Narayan Swamy15.483
PS K3 (1451cc – 1650cc)Shaik Hussain Pasha17.241
PS K4 (1651cc – 2050cc)Thrishal M.S15.545
PS K5 (2051cc – 2550cc)Shreyas Mahendra13.618
PS K7 (3061cc – 4002cc)Vidyaprakash Damodaran13.351
PS K8 (4003cc – 5100cc)Karthik KV10.315
PS L4 (1651cc – 2050cc)Naveen Reddy Kesara13.749
PS L6 (2551cc – 3060cc)Aakash Durai12.571
Indian Open M1 (Up to 2750cc)Shreyas Mahendra12.963
Indian Open M2 (Up to 4002cc)Shreyas Mahendra13.259
Indian Open M3 (Unlimited)Yajur Miglani10.656

Round 2 results

CategoryCompetitorTime (secs)
Unrestricted (N1)Sean Rogers Pachigalla8.948
PS K2 (1151cc – 1450cc)Narayan Swamy14.88
PS K3 (1451cc – 1650cc)Vinay SM15.036
PS K4 (1651cc – 2050cc)Thrishal M.S15.79
PS K5 (2051cc – 2550cc)Vijay Raju13.846
PS K7 (3061cc – 4002cc)Vidyaprakash Damodaran13.83
PS K8 (4003cc – 5100cc)Karthik KV10.23
PS L4 (1651cc – 2050cc)Naveen Reddy Kesara13.624
PS L6 (2551cc – 3060cc)Aakash Durai12.415
Indian Open M1 (Up to 2750cc)Vijay Raju14.195
Indian Open M2 (Up to 4002cc)Vidyaprakash Damodaran13.236
Indian Open M3 (Unlimited)Sean Rogers Pachigalla8.955
